Golden Retrievers have a dense double coat of fur that requires regular grooming to keep it healthy and free of mats and tangles.
Start grooming your puppy early so he gets used to the process. Brush their coat at least several times a week to prevent tangles and remove loose fur.
In addition, regular nail trimming, ear cleaning, and dental care are essential for their overall health and well-being.

Golden Retriever dogs are energetic and physically active. Participate in daily play sessions, interactive games, and short walks.
